Antique Candlestick Holders For Sale on 1stDibs

An assortment of antique candlestick holders is available at 1stDibs. Each of these unique antique candlestick holders was constructed with extraordinary care, often using metal, bronze and wood. Antique candlestick holders have been produced for many years, with earlier versions available from the 18th Century and newer variations made as recently as the 20th Century. Antique candlestick holders bearing Victorian or Georgian hallmarks are very popular at 1stDibs. Tiffany Studios, Interi and Wedgwood each produced beautiful antique candlestick holders that are worth considering.

How Much are Antique Candlestick Holders?

Antique candlestick holders can differ in price owing to various characteristics — the average selling price at 1stDibs is $1,797, while the lowest priced sells for $2 and the highest can go for as much as $428,500.

    To tell if a candle holder is solid antique brass, you can try placing a magnet on it. Brass is not magnetic, so if there is any attraction, the piece is unlikely to be solid brass. On 1stDibs, shop a collection of candle holders.
